Now I will teach you the mastery of parting of gold from silver when
they be mingled together. Forsooth you know well that there be many
works in the which gold and silver be mingled, as in gilding of vessels
and jewels. Therefore when you will draw the one from the other, put all
that mixture into a strong water made of vitriol and of saltpetre and the
silver will be dissolved, and not the gold. Then you have that one parted
from the other. And if you will dissolve the gold to water, put then in the
corrosive water, sal ammoniac, and that water without doubt will
dissolve gold into water.
The science to draw out of fine gold quinta essentia is this. First you
shall reduce gold into calx as I told you heretofore. Then take vinegar
distilled, or else old wine purified from the faeces, and put it in a vessel
glazed, and the liquor shall be in the height of four inches, and therein
cast the calx of gold, and set it to the strong sun in summer time, there to
abide. And soon after you shall see as it were a liquor of oil, ascend up
floating above in manner of a skin or of a surface. Gather that away with
a subtle spoon or else a feather, and put it into a vessel of glass in the
which be put water heretofore. And thus gather it many times in the day
unto the time that there ascends no more. And after do vapour away the
water at the fire. And the quinta essentia of the gold will abide beneath.
And many philosophers call this quinta essentia an oil incombustible,
